SA gets a new Medical Aid - for pets!
An easy to
understand medical aid for our pets has been lacking until now, but
a new innovative company, MedipetSA, has taken the initiative,
launching its first product for dogs and cats.
It's hard
enough for us as humans to wade through the multitude of options
available to us from the various medical aid offerings, so a simple
one for dogs and cats to read is as essential for their owners.
MedipetSA allows pet owners to opt for an uncomplicated
comprehensive medical aid for dogs and cats. It's easy to understand
and you know what you are getting for your money.
Whilst we are
duty-bound to care for our pets the escalating, and often
misunderstood, costs of a vets examination or treatment forces many
either to ignore a problem, or wait for their number to be called at
the SPCA or similar facility.
"Medical cover
for pets is commonplace overseas and whilst a few companies in South
Africa have tried to offer various products, neither pet owners or
vets have used them in any great numbers mainly due to the
complicated plans and schemes on offer", says Richard Neville, MD of
MedipetSA.
Pet insurance
companies oversees are seen as essential, yet South Africans have
been a little more resistant when it comes to reading pet insurance
policies with what sometimes seems to be more exclusions and
opt-outs than actual cover.
The monthly
premium covers costs of up to R25000 per annum, though
pre-authorisation is required for certain procedures. This will
dissuade pets from running up huge vet bills for unnecessary
procedures such as cosmetic surgery.
"For a monthly
premium of just R125 for dogs and R115 for cats, not only will this
be good for owners' pockets, but also for the welfare of their pets
and those registering online at
www.medipetsa.co.za before January the 1st will get a
discount on the premium ", adds Neville.
Pets from 8
weeks to 9 years old qualify for life, giving peace of mind to
owners and pets alike.
